Some ideas by Owenoke

Greenwich has a relatively poor food scene for a town of 60,000 and only 35 miles from NYC. But if you are in town and need places, here are a few:

Little Pub in Cos Cob, good pub fare/burgers.

Fat Poodle in Old Greenwich is a go to for decent date night dinner.

Applausi is serviceable Italian I’m Old Greenwich. Valbella, near your hotel is overpriced red sauce but odds are you will run into Regis and Joy.

If you have a car, The Whelk in Westport is great, as is the Tavern at Silver Barns in Norwalk.

I’d second the idea of driving up to Zuppardi’s (get the sausage pie special) in West Haven or Sally’s in New Haven for a pie. Best pizza ever.
